Understanding Space-Time

Before diving into theories of time travel, it’s crucial to comprehend the concept of space-time. Initially introduced by Einstein’s theory of relativity, space-time is a four-dimensional continuum merging the three dimensions of space with the dimension of time. This merging suggests that space and time are interconnected, meaning movements through one can influence the other.

This linkage opens up fascinating possibilities for traveling across both dimensions. Let’s break down the implications of space-time as we explore the theories of time travel.

The Fabric of Space-Time

Think of space-time as a fabric that can be warped and stretched. Large masses, like planets and stars, cause indentations in this fabric. This warping is what leads to gravity as we know it. The more significant the mass, the greater the curvature. In our quest for space-time colonization, manipulating these curves might allow for travel across vast distances or even into other eras.

Popular Theories of Time Travel

As we probe deeper into the concept of space-time colonization, it is essential to look at various theories that have emerged over the years regarding time travel.

1. Wormholes

One of the most discussed theories of time travel involves wormholes—hypothetical passages through space-time that could create shortcuts between distant points in the universe. The theory proposes that if we could harness these wormholes, it might be possible to travel not just through space but also through time.

The Two Ends of a Wormhole

Consider a wormhole as a bridge between two points in space and time. If both ends of the wormhole could be manipulated, one could theoretically travel back in time or jump to a distant part of the universe. However, the challenge lies in the stability of these structures. Current theories suggest they would require "exotic matter" with negative energy density to remain stable.

2. Time Dilation

Another intriguing concept related to time travel involves time dilation. According to Einstein’s theory of relativity, time is not a constant and moves slower for objects moving at high speeds compared to those that are stationary. This effect, which has been observed with high-speed jets and particles, suggests that if we could travel close to the speed of light, we might be able to experience time differently.

Practical Implications of Time Dilation

In practical terms, astronauts inching toward the speed of light would age more slowly than those remaining on Earth. As space-time colonizers, this phenomenon could allow humanity to explore other planets and returns to Earth only to find decades or even centuries have passed.

3. Closed Timelike Curves

Another theoretical method for time travel is the concept of closed timelike curves (CTCs), which suggest the possibility of looping through time. CTCs offer a theoretical framework where you could travel back to your own past. However, this opens paradoxical questions, such as the famous grandfather paradox, which challenges the consistency of time travel.

Technological Barriers to Time Travel

While theories abound, the path to actualizing time travel remains fraught with challenges. The existing limitations of our understanding of physics, technology, and energy resources are significant barriers.

Energy Requirements

The energy required to manipulate space-time is currently beyond human capacity. For example, sustaining a wormhole would demand immense amounts of exotic energy, which we are yet to discover. To achieve space-time colonization, breakthroughs in energy production and the discovery of new forms of matter are essential.

Scientific Limitations

Our current scientific models still rely heavily on theoretical physics. Many proposed methods of time travel remain speculative with no experimental proof backing them. Innovations in quantum physics or a deeper understanding of gravity may pave the way for advancements in time travel theories.
